Understanding the Art of Porting PC Games to Switch
In the ever-evolving world of gaming, the proliferation of platforms means that developers often face the challenge of porting PC games to Switch. As the Nintendo Switch gains popularity and a diverse gaming audience, understanding the intricacies of this process is crucial for developers looking to expand their reach and maximize profit. This article dives deep into why porting is essential, the challenges involved, and effective strategies for successful game adaptation.
The Importance of Porting PC Games to Switch
The Nintendo Switch has established itself as a formidable player in the gaming market, thanks to its hybrid nature and unique game library. By enabling users to seamlessly transition between handheld and console gaming, it has attracted a broad audience. This opens up an opportunity for developers to increase their player base by porting existing PC titles to this platform.
Expanding Reach to a New Audience
Porting PC games to the Switch allows developers to tap into a different demographics of gamers, as many Nintendo consumers prefer exclusive titles. Thus, adapting popular PC games can lead to:
- Increased Revenue: More platforms mean more opportunities for sales.
- Enhanced Brand Recognition: Successfully porting a game can enhance a developer's reputation.
- Diverse Gameplay Experiences: Offering different versions of a game can attract various types of players.
Understanding the Challenges of Porting
While the benefits are notable, porting PC games to Switch isn't without its challenges. Developers must navigate several hurdles:
Technical Constraints
The Switch, while powerful for its size, pales in comparison to modern gaming PCs. Developers must optimize graphics, adjust control schemes, and manage memory constraints effectively. For instance:
- Reducing polygon counts and texture resolutions to maintain performance.
- Utilizing the Switch's unique control system, including motion controls and touch screens.
- Ensuring a stable frame rate to provide a smooth gameplay experience on portable hardware.
Adapting Game Mechanics
The mechanics that worked flawlessly on PC may not translate perfectly to console gaming. This requires developers to:
- Redesign Controls: Adapting control schemes to fit the Switch's Joy-Con layout.
- Restructure Gameplay: Modifying levels or gameplay pacing for a handheld experience.
- Testing Across Modes: Ensuring that the game performs equally well in docked and handheld modes.
Effective Strategies for Porting PC Games to Switch
Despite the challenges, many developers have successfully ported their titles to the Switch. Here are some effective strategies that can lead to successful adaptations:
Early Planning and Prototyping
It’s essential to start with a clear plan. Developers should consider the Switch's hardware capabilities from the onset of game development. Early prototyping can highlight potential issues, enabling smoother transitions later. Key points include:
- Hardware Limitations: Understanding the Switch’s architecture early helps avoid costly redesigns.
- Community Feedback: Leveraging player feedback to inform adaptations.
- Agile Development: Remaining flexible to iterate on design choices based on early testing.
Utilizing Game Engines with Porting Support
Many modern game engines, such as Unity and Unreal Engine, provide built-in tools to assist with porting. These features can streamline the process significantly:
- Cross-Platform Support: Using engines that easily transition builds from PC to Switch.
- Hardware-Specific Features: Implementing native features that enhance gameplay on the Switch.
Focus on User Experience
The user experience should be at the forefront of any porting decision. Developers should consider:
- Intuitive Control Schemes: Simplifying controls to suit the Switch while maintaining depth.
- Visual Fidelity: Adjusting graphics while ensuring appealing visuals for handheld play.
- Performance Optimization: Ensuring smooth gameplay across all environments.
Leveraging Market Trends
Understanding market demands can significantly influence the success of a port. By keeping an eye on trends, developers can tailor their adaptations to meet user expectations:
Studying Successful Port Examples
Studying games that have made successful transitions to the Switch can provide valuable insights. Titles like "Stardew Valley" and "Hollow Knight" exemplify successful adaptations that retain their core gameplay while offering a new experience on Switch. Observing what made these games successful can guide future porting decisions.
Engaging in Community Dialogue
Maintaining an open dialogue with the gaming community through forums, social media, and feedback surveys ensures that developers are aligned with expectations. Understanding player preferences can guide design decisions, making adaptations more successful.
Conclusion: Embracing the Future of Gaming
As the gaming landscape evolves, the ability to port PC games to Switch will become increasingly important. Developers who invest the time and resources into understanding the nuances of this process will not only enhance their game’s reach but also establish themselves as leaders in the competitive gaming market. Embracing new platforms, optimizing gameplay, and responding to community feedback are crucial steps toward delivering cherished gaming experiences to a broader audience. The challenge of porting is undeniable, but with the right strategies and mindset, it’s an opportunity waiting to be seized.
Transitioning to Success: Final Thoughts
In summary, the opportunity to transition beloved PC games to the indistinct charm of the Nintendo Switch is not just about revenue; it’s about community, engagement, and the art of game development itself. For developers looking to explore this vibrant intersection, investing in comprehensive planning, leveraging technology, and staying connected with players ensures a promising future for both their games and their businesses. The gaming community is watching, and now is the time to innovate and inspire through successful porting.